19659005] Amazon is not growing as fast as it used to be. And over the next three months, sales are expected to increase even more slowly. But that does not mean that the high fly of the online retailer would be over – on the contrary.

Amazon, the largest online retailer in the world, continues to benefit from the growth of e-commerce and the prosperity of IT services. The turnover and profits rose again significantly in the second quarter – just in terms of profit, Amazon surprised positively. Sales figures were somewhat disappointing. The stock, which had been booming for some time, gained 2% after working hours

Between April and the end of June, revenues rose 39% to $ 52.9 billion (45%). $ 22 billion). As a result, revenue growth was not as strong as at the beginning of the year. The experts had also forecast slightly higher incomes. In the three months from July to the end of September, growth is expected to slow down somewhat. For the third quarter, Amazon's boss, Jeff Bezos, is targeting sales between $ 54 billion and $ 57 billion, an increase of 23 to 31 percent over the previous year. Again, Amazon is below the current estimate of the experts.

The positive surprise, however, was Amazon's profit. That climbed to $ 2.5 billion. A year ago, the group had only earned $ 197 million. For this course, Amazon was worth more than the top ten Dax companies combined. On Thursday, the title of Amazon had lost just under three percent in regular trading because of the weakness of all technology stocks due to disappointing Facebook figures.

Amazon's paper has been high for years. In 2018 alone, the stock market value of the company has so far increased by more than half to 877 billion US dollars (753 billion euros). This makes the online retailer after Apple the second most valuable listed company in the world. With the rise of the Amazon, founder and CEO Jeff Bezos has become the richest man in the world. His fortune, which consists primarily of the company's stock, stands at about $ 149 billion, according to a Bloomberg news agency release.
